What does Eutelsat Communications do?

Eutelsat Communications SA is a leading company in the field of satellite communications and is headquartered in Paris, France. The company's history dates back to 1977 when the European Space Agency (ESA) and various European telecommunications companies worked together to develop commercial satellite communication. Eutelsat was founded in 1983 and has since played a pioneering role in satellite communications. Eutelsat owns and operates a comprehensive network of satellites covering the entire globe and providing high capacity for data, voice, and video transmission. Through Eutelsat, companies and governments around the world can communicate with each other and have access to various television channels. Eutelsat is an important player in the global satellite industry and offers its customers a wide range of services. Eutelsat is divided into five business areas, all dependent on satellite communication: video, data, broadband, government and institutional services, and mobile connectivity. Eutelsat's video division includes satellite television, digital platforms, and broadband services. Eutelsat offers over 6,000 television channels that can be received through the Eutelsat satellite network in Europe, the Middle East, Africa, Asia, and the Americas. Eutelsat works with broadcasters, content providers, and pay-TV providers to deliver a wide range of TV programs to multiple international markets. Eutelsat Data offers various data connectivity solutions for businesses, governments, and institutions. The offering includes connections for mobile satellite communication, application center networking, real-time data transmission, as well as business continuity and disaster recovery solutions. Eutelsat's broadband division offers services for broadband communication, including satellite internet access. This is particularly interesting for rural areas that do not have access to DSL or fiber optic connections. Eutelsat's government and institutional services provide satellite-based communication solutions for government agencies, military and emergency services, air and maritime services, as well as humanitarian organizations. Eutelsat's mobile connectivity solutions allow mobile network operators to expand their capacity with satellites by up to 40%. These solutions are ideal for areas with low network coverage or for emergency situations where infrastructure needs to be brought online quickly and reliably.
